On the night of June 3, Russians attacked Odessa once again. Residential buildings and civilian infrastructure were damaged, and cars were burned.

This was reported by Odessa Mayor Gennady Trukhanov.

According to the State Emergency Service, four people were injured.

Fires broke out at various locations, the largest of which was in a warehouse storing food products. Two cars were also burned in the private sector, and garages and houses were damaged.

Twenty-two State Emergency Service vehicles and 72 rescuers worked at the scene, and three vehicles and 12 people from volunteers, the Ukrainian National Guard, and the city council were also involved.
